Navigation menu html5 tutorial pdf

In this article well go through all the steps required to build a simple navigation bar and we will see how to make it responsive. May 01, 2012 this tutorial will incorporate innovative solutions to creating a collapsible navigation menu using the power of jquery, css3, and html5 with four sample navigations. Html5 tutorial pdf css3 tutorial pdf html5 tutorial. Input tools are very important in data based web applications. The all remaining demos and examples have been described well in the pdf version of html5 tutorial. Text content is released under creative commons bysa.

The html5javascript menu bar is a graphical user interface control that serves as a navigation header for your web application or site. The html5 nav element is used to semantically mark the navigation section or sections of a page a page may contain more than one nav section. In html5 a few recently made input types have been included, input types are useful in receiving the input in a desired format. Each single menu item gets a waterdroplike effect when you hover the mouse on it. Notice that not all links of a document should be inside a element. Html was primarily designed as a language for semantically describing scientific documents, although its. How to create a dropdown nav menu with html5, css3 and jquery. The tag defines a set of navigation links notice that not all links of a document should be inside a element. In this project, i have used html5 and css3 to design above responsive navigation menus.

A navigation bar does not need list markers set margin. How to create simple drop down navigation menu with html and. For this reason, many web sites use css rollover that can be easily maintained without changing so often. To add the menu, were first going to use the nav tag. In this post im going to show you how to create dynamic navigation menu with javascript and css.

Beginner web development start your journey towards becoming a bona fide web developer by learning these foundational concepts of coding rating. Use these tutorials as inspiration for creating your own amazing and custom navigation bars. Html5 and css3 tutorial provides to its users, the free pdf. This css3 menu has a rich look with indepth effects and transition animations. Tutorial css3 horizontal navigation menu fold effect. By using unordered lists you have a couple different options on how to output the results, but as long as the menu has some basic hierarchy you can generate it. Create a fun animated navigation menu with pure css. Insert this following meta tag syntax under your title so your website will automatically adjust to smaller screen sizes and viewports. Building web applications with html5, css3, and javascript. Browsers, such as screen readers for disabled users, can use this element to determine whether to omit the initial rendering of this content. But some demos and examples have not been described for confidential or privacy purpose. Learn from these navigation menu tutorials and make your website a bit more userfriendly. Mar 06, 2017 learn how to create responsive navbar using html5 and css3. Ciw web and mobile design series student guide ccl02cdhtcsck1405 version 1.

You can change the breakpoint through media queries in the css. A navigation bar is one of the main components of a website, in my opinion the most important one, it is in fact the first section that the user sees when heshe enter a website and it links to the other main parts. Then we will add a fixed width and height to the menu, rounded corners and the css3 gradients. In this tutorial, well take a look and see what we can achieve with html5 and css3 when it comes to the staple of current web sites. How to create a responsive navigation bar with html, css. Youve probably seen it on most websites and app menus on your mobile device. This site is the best for beginners thanks there is many types of menu and define easy.

The html5 notes for professionals book is compiled from stack overflow documentation, the content is written by the beautiful people at stack overflow. Fun animated navigation menu with pure css download tutorial 16. Responsive dropdown menu with source code download free. In this tutorial were going to use the latest web technologies to create responsive navigation menu bar which will be flexible enough. Html navigation menu readycoded navigation menus providing responsive features and nice animations a tutorial that explains how to create a morphing dropdown navigation menu as seen on with few lines of html, css and javascript.

Nicer navigation with css3 transitions demo tutorial 15. Here is a collection of responsive menus that you can use to build your own website. Week04 lab01 css navigation bar open computing facility. So far one of the best solutions i have found is to model the menus after the son of suckerfish xhtmlcss solution that is pretty well documented on the internet now combined with some logic on the server to render the unordered list. The navigation menu is ready for desktop use now, however we should also include some love for mobile users. Jun 24, 2019 the html5 javascript menu bar is a graphical user interface control that serves as a navigation header for your web application or site. Html5 html5 notes for professionals notes for professionals free programming books disclaimer this is an uno cial free book created for educational purposes and is not a liated with o cial html5 groups or companys. Beginner web development start your journey towards becoming a bona fide web developer by learning these foundational. Hi guys, i have got this html5 and css3 ebook from one of my friend.

Responsive drawer navigation in pure css css script. Well also use jquery to handle the effects and add the finishing touches for us. Html5 enables a browser to play video and audio files new hmtl5 input element types. To me, is a mix between and, with the added constriction that should be used specifically for navigation, whereas can be for anything that might be called a menu including a navigation bar. Creating an animated dropdown navigation menu in html5css3 and webkit this is a tutorial for beginner and intermediate html5 and css3 developers who want to. How to create a dropdown nav menu with html5, css3 and. It has all the topics from html5 to design a rich interactive websites. For instance, there may be a site wide navigation menu inside the header bar of the page, and a content related navigation menu in the left side of the page. This tutorial will incorporate innovative solutions to creating a collapsible navigation menu using the power of jquery, css3, and html5 with four sample navigations. In this tutorial you learn how to use html5 and css3 to bring a html website to life. Html5 spec from whatwg the world wide webs markup language has always been html. Were going to use the anchor tag and then give the tag an id called menuicon. Within the nav tag, were first going to add the menu s hamburger icon. Jul 14, 2015 a responsive navigation solution which uses input.

But remember, web crawlers wont crawl texts dynamically generated by javascript. The element is intended only for major block of navigation links. It is assumed that you are familiar with web development,free courses in pdf for download under 681 pages. To make a navigation bar using the html5 nav element, encase the links within the nav tag. Html5 and css3 have many advantages like faster loading times,greater functionalities and more flexibility. In this tutorial you will learn how to create a dark, slick and simple css3 animated menu. Responsive dropdown navigation menu using html css and javascript responsive navbar tutorial online tutorials. For the following tutorials you can use the navigation menu on the left to browse what you are interested in, or you can read it from cover to cover pressing the button next, located in the bottom of the page. Using a media query i target devices with a max width of 760px and make a few changes to the. Yes, nav element is meant for the area with collection of site navigational links. Using a media query i target devices with a max width of 760px and make a. Recently, i have made a tutorial about making a responsive navigation menu. See credits at the end of this book whom contributed to the various chapters.

Oct 25, 2014 in this weeks tutorial, we will create a horizontal navigation menu foldunfold effect using css3, lexus inspired us to recreate this tutorial but we will using only css3 no javascript is required for this tutorial and the results are amazing, we will be using css rotatex function, 3d transform and transition properties to create the fold. Rocketbar a jquery and css3 persistent navigation menu. Learn html5 and css3 fundamentals as you build two websites in this introductory course to web development. The easiest ways is to use a simple unordered list as your html structure and then style it using css. Oh yes, more tutorials and this time we have 20 fresh html5 and css3 menu tutorials. Responsive pure css menu tutorial no javascript duration. Creating an animated dropdown navigation menu in html5css3. Navigation tab using html5 and css3 no javascript web. How to create simple drop down navigation menu with html and css tutorial for beginners watch out my other videos.

Apr 02, 20 oh yes, more tutorials and this time we have 20 fresh html5 and css3 menu tutorials. Although we have included all the script related to html5 and css3 on the website. In this tutorial i am going to show you how to simple navigation bar with html css. With responsive design being all the rage these days though youre faced with some new challenges when creating a menu design. With these tutorials you can learn how to create interactive and user friendly menus using css3 and html5. Create a dropdown navigation menu with html5 and css3 there are some great solutions to dropdown navigation menus, like the superfish jquery plugin for example. So, i have attached this project source code, you can download it, and use it for a personal project. Creating an animated dropdown navigation menu in html5. May 14, 2018 responsive dropdown navigation menu using html css and javascript responsive navbar tutorial online tutorials. Here you just hover the mouse on the dropdown host. Oct 22, 2012 navigation menu is one of the important element of a good user friendly website.

Responsive navigation menu bar tutorial with html5 and css3. However, it might be hard to maintain it when we have to change html pages that include rollover images. Responsive navigation menu bar tutorial with html5 and. Week04 lab01 css navigation bar image rollover is a great technique to make a navigation bar more interactive. Html5 spec from whatwg the world wide webs markup language has always been. How to create a responsive navigation bar with html, css and. As what the name suggests, the new nav element is for navigation. With the right styling you can even achieve some creative effects lets get right into the code and build a simple menu. This modified text is an extract of the original stack overflow documentation created by following contributors and released under cc bysa 3. Html5 training guide this training guide is designated to it professionals who want to develop with html documents such as websites or webapplications. This menu bar is really a solution to the long dropdown menus.

With these functional menus, youll make browsing your site easier for your visitors. The code in the example above is the standard code used in both vertical, and horizontal navigation bars, which you will learn more about in the next chapters. You will be building menus using both horizontal and vertical navigation design. Jul 15, 20 learn from these navigation menu tutorials and make your website a bit more userfriendly. Drop down menu tutorials in html5, jquery, and css3. Code up an unordered list, float it left and youre good to go.

Well also be using media queries to help make the menu responsive so it can be used on any mobile device. We will start to remove the margin, padding, border and outline from all the elements of the menu. In this tutorial we will be creating a basic responsive navigation menu with dropdown using only html and css. Javascript menu bar html5 navigation menu syncfusion.

The element is intended only for major block of navigation links browsers, such as screen readers for disabled users, can use this element to determine whether to omit the initial rendering of this content. May 09, 2019 a navigation bar is one of the main components of a website, in my opinion the most important one, it is in fact the first section that the user sees when heshe enter a website and it links to the other main parts. In this weeks tutorial, we will create a horizontal navigation menu foldunfold effect using css3, lexus inspired us to recreate this tutorial but we will using only css3 no javascript is required for this tutorial and the results are amazing, we will be using css rotatex function, 3d transform and transition properties to create the fold. To make a navigation bar using the html5 nav element, encase the links within the. Learn how to create responsive navbar using html5 and css3. Navigational links of a website are mostly placed at the header and sidebar, sometimes, it can be in footer. To me, is a mix between and menu, with the added constriction that should be used specifically for navigation, whereas menu can be for anything that might be called a menu including a navigation bar. Create collapsible navigation menus, faq widgets, basic toggle functions, etc. Starting with how to plan out your website, including a header, navigation bar, content area and footer ill show you all the techniques used to create.

407 1177 681 484 1243 1193 701 1008 135 29 119 1509 820 784 545 1317 1392 474 674 1459 644 748 628 115 1064 981 812 554 1045